Liferay vs. Magento: A Comprehensive Comparison of Powerful CMS Platforms

Liferay vs. Magento: A Comprehensive Comparison of Powerful CMS Platforms


Welcome to the comprehensive comparison guide between Liferay and Magento, two popular Content Management Systems (CMS). Choosing the right CMS is crucial for digital leaders and decision-makers, as it can directly impact their organization's success in managing and delivering content. In this guide, we will explore the key features and capabilities of both Liferay and Magento, assisting you in making an informed choice for your organization’s CMS needs.

Foundations of CMS

Liferay and Magento are built on different foundations, targeting distinct aspects of content management. Liferay is an enterprise-grade open-source CMS that focuses on providing a unified platform for content creation, management, and collaboration across multiple channels. It offers robust features for intranets, extranets, and websites, making it ideal for organizations with complex content management requirements.

On the other hand, Magento is a widely used CMS tailored specifically for e-commerce. It specializes in offering customizable and scalable solutions for creating and managing online stores. With a strong focus on product catalogs, shopping carts, and checkout processes, Magento empowers businesses to create seamless online shopping experiences for their customers.

While Liferay is versatile and can handle e-commerce needs to some extent, Magento provides focused e-commerce functionality, making it an ideal choice for businesses primarily focused on online retail.

Now, let's dive deeper into the features and capabilities of Liferay and Magento to help you make an informed decision.

Design & User Experience

When it comes to design and user experience, both Liferay and Magento offer powerful tools to create visually appealing and user-friendly websites.

Liferay provides a wide range of customizable templates and themes, allowing organizations to create unique and engaging designs. It also offers a drag-and-drop interface for easy content creation and page building. Additionally, Liferay's responsive design capabilities ensure that websites render seamlessly across various devices, enhancing the user experience.

Magento, being an e-commerce-focused CMS, excels in providing visually stunning online stores. It offers a vast collection of responsive themes and templates specifically designed for e-commerce businesses. With its intuitive admin panel, businesses can easily manage products, categories, and customer interactions. Moreover, Magento's built-in SEO features contribute to enhancing the visibility and search engine rankings of online stores, ensuring a seamless shopping experience for customers.

Both Liferay and Magento prioritize user experience, but the choice between the two would depend on your organization's specific requirements and whether e-commerce functionality is the primary focus.

Content Management

Effective content management is a crucial aspect of any CMS, and both Liferay and Magento provide robust content management capabilities.

Liferay offers a comprehensive suite of tools for content creation, organization, and publishing. Its straightforward interface allows users to create and manage content with ease. Liferay's intuitive workflow management system enables collaboration and streamlines content approval processes. Additionally, Liferay's version control and document management features enhance content governance and ensure regulatory compliance.

Magento, though primarily focused on e-commerce functionality, provides powerful content management tools specifically catered to product catalogs and descriptions. It allows businesses to efficiently manage and showcase their products, including images, attributes, and pricing. Magento also supports content staging, allowing businesses to schedule content updates and promotions.

While both Liferay and Magento offer content management solutions, Liferay's broader range of content management features make it a suitable choice for organizations needing a comprehensive CMS platform for various content types, including documents, images, videos, and more.

Next, we will explore collaboration and user management features in Liferay and Magento.

Collaboration & User Management

Smooth collaboration and efficient user management are key requirements for organizations using a CMS. Liferay and Magento offer different sets of features in these areas.

Liferay excels in providing robust collaboration features, making it an ideal choice for organizations with multiple teams and departments working together. It offers built-in social collaboration tools, such as wikis, forums, blogs, and document libraries, fostering effective knowledge-sharing and collaboration. Liferay also provides a powerful permission management system, allowing administrators to define user roles and access levels.

Magento, being an e-commerce-focused CMS, emphasizes user management from a customer perspective. It provides features for managing customer accounts, personalizing shopping experiences, and facilitating customer interactions. Magento's customer management capabilities enable businesses to offer personalized product recommendations, targeted promotions, and an overall enhanced shopping experience.

If your organization seeks comprehensive collaboration features for internal teams, Liferay's social collaboration tools make it the ideal choice. However, if your focus is on managing and enhancing customer experiences, Magento's customer management capabilities would be more suitable.

Up next, we will discuss performance, scalability, and hosting considerations in Liferay and Magento.

Performance, Scalability, & Hosting

Performance, scalability, and reliable hosting are crucial factors to consider when choosing a CMS.

Liferay, being an enterprise-grade CMS, is built with performance and scalability in mind. It is capable of handling large volumes of content, user interactions, and concurrent visitors. Liferay's infrastructure supports clustering, load balancing, and caching mechanisms, ensuring optimal performance even under high traffic loads. Liferay can be hosted on-premises or in the cloud, giving organizations flexibility in choosing their hosting infrastructure.

Magento, being specifically built for e-commerce, offers exceptional performance and scalability for online stores. It is designed to handle high transaction volumes, product inventories, and customer interactions. Magento provides caching mechanisms, indexing optimizations, and content delivery networks (CDNs) to enhance website performance. When it comes to hosting, Magento recommends dedicated hosting environments or managed cloud-based solutions for optimal performance and security.

Both Liferay and Magento prioritize performance and scalability. However, if your organization's primary focus is e-commerce, Magento's specialized optimizations make it an ideal choice. Conversely, if your organization requires a broader CMS platform for various content types and extensive collaboration, Liferay's scalability and flexibility make it a strong contender.

Next, we will explore the customization, extensions, and ecosystem of Liferay and Magento.

Customization, Extensions, & Ecosystem

Customization capabilities, availability of extensions, and a thriving ecosystem play an important role in expanding the functionality of a CMS.

Liferay offers extensive customization options, allowing organizations to tailor their digital experience platforms according to their specific needs. It provides a comprehensive set of APIs, frameworks, and developer tools, empowering organizations to build custom applications, integrations, and themes. Liferay's marketplace offers a wide range of extensions and plugins developed by Liferay and the community, enabling businesses to enhance their digital experiences with ease.

Magento, being a widely adopted e-commerce CMS, boasts a vast ecosystem of extensions and themes. It provides a robust marketplace where businesses can find ready-to-use extensions developed by Magento and third-party developers. This ecosystem ensures that businesses have access to a variety of features and integrations to extend the functionality of their online stores. Magento also offers strong customization capabilities, allowing organizations to build unique shopping experiences tailored to their brand.

If customization and a vibrant extension marketplace are critical for your organization, both Liferay and Magento provide strong options. Liferay's emphasis on customization and building comprehensive digital platforms makes it an ideal choice for organizations needing versatile solutions. On the other hand, Magento's specialized e-commerce extensions and themes make it a leading choice for businesses primarily focused on online retail.

We will now delve into SEO, marketing, and monetization features offered by Liferay and Magento.

SEO, Marketing, & Monetization

For businesses looking to drive organic traffic, engage customers, and monetize their online presence, SEO, marketing, and monetization features are key considerations in a CMS.

Liferay offers robust content management and SEO capabilities, allowing organizations to optimize their websites for search engines. Liferay supports customizable URLs, meta tags, and XML sitemaps, enabling businesses to improve their online visibility. Liferay's marketing features include personalized content delivery, targeted campaigns, and analytics to track visitor behavior and engagement. Additionally, Liferay supports integration with marketing automation platforms for more advanced marketing capabilities.

Magento, as an e-commerce-focused CMS, provides powerful SEO features specifically tailored for online retail. It supports features such as canonical URLs, meta tags, schema.org markup, and search engine-friendly URLs to enhance search engine visibility. Magento also facilitates marketing initiatives through features like personalized promotions, upselling, and cross-selling. It integrates with popular marketing automation tools, enabling businesses to streamline their marketing efforts seamlessly.

Whether your organization requires broad SEO and marketing capabilities or more specialized e-commerce-focused features, both Liferay and Magento cater to these needs. The decision would depend on the primary focus and goals of your organization.

Now, let's discuss the vital aspects of security and compliance in Liferay and Magento.

Security & Compliance

Security and compliance are critical considerations when selecting a CMS, especially for organizations handling sensitive customer data and operating in regulated industries.

Liferay takes security seriously and provides robust features to ensure data protection. It offers role-based access controls, encryption mechanisms, secure storage, and protection against common vulnerabilities. Liferay also adheres to international security standards, such as ISO 27001, and provides detailed documentation to assist organizations in their compliance endeavors.

Magento, being an e-commerce CMS, understands the importance of secure transactions and customer data protection. It incorporates security features like PCI DSS compliance, secure payment gateways, and advanced fraud protection mechanisms. Magento regularly releases security patches and updates to address any emerging threats. The platform also offers comprehensive documentation and guidelines to assist businesses in achieving compliance with industry regulations.

Both Liferay and Magento prioritize security and provide robust measures to protect data. Depending on your organization's industry and specific compliance requirements, either CMS can be chosen with confidence.

Lastly, let's delve into migration, support, and maintenance considerations for Liferay and Magento.

Migration, Support, & Maintenance

Migrating from an existing CMS and ensuring ongoing support and maintenance are vital aspects that organizations need to consider in their CMS selection process.

Liferay provides resources and tools to assist organizations in migrating from other CMS platforms. It offers migration frameworks, documentation, and professional services to ensure a smooth transition. Additionally, Liferay provides comprehensive support and maintenance services, including bug fixes, security updates, and technical assistance.

Magento offers migration tools and guidelines for businesses looking to migrate their e-commerce websites from other platforms. Moreover, Magento has a network of certified solution partners who can assist in seamless migration. Magento provides support and maintenance through its global network of technical experts, ensuring that businesses receive timely assistance and updates.

Both Liferay and Magento prioritize the migration process and offer ongoing support and maintenance services. By following recommended migration practices and engaging with their respective support ecosystems, organizations can ensure a successful transition and reliable long-term support.


In conclusion, Liferay and Magento are powerful CMS options, each catering to specific requirements and use cases. Liferay excels in providing a comprehensive platform for content management, collaboration, and customization, making it ideal for organizations with diverse digital needs. Magento, on the other hand, specializes in e-commerce, offering extensive capabilities for creating and managing online stores.

Your final choice between Liferay and Magento should be based on the specific goals and requirements of your organization. Consider factors such as the nature of your content, the need for collaboration, the focus on e-commerce, scalability requirements, customization options, marketing needs, security, and ongoing support. Evaluating these aspects will help you make an informed decision that aligns with your organization's digital strategy and ensures success in managing your content effectively.


Martin Dejnicki
Martin Dejnicki

Martin is a digital product innovator and pioneer who built and optimized his first website back in 1996 when he was 16 years old. Since then, he has helped many companies win in the digital space, including Walmart, IBM, Rogers, Canada Post, TMX Group and TD Securities. Recently, he worked with the Deploi team to build an elegant publishing platform for creative writers and a novel algorithmic trading platform.